Transaction 57f9038727403425fc544618216707c7d725dee14452ed6dafa01cb12a935cb5
1 Input
2 Outputs
- 57f9038727403425fc544618216707c7d725dee14452ed6dafa01cb12a935cb5:0
- 57f9038727403425fc544618216707c7d725dee14452ed6dafa01cb12a935cb5:1
value 6824
address 13vxEA3jgjpJX1zMrMWoRU1SPVxVSCLcWM
value 91664
address 3MH8eXFxWNzbJnfj7vwSEJAz9A61QmQut2